An H-back is an offensive position in American football. The H-back lines up similarly to a tight end, but is "set back" from the line of scrimmage, and is thus counted as one of the four "backs" in the offensive formation. The H-back, while similar in name, should not be confused with "halfback" or "running back", which … See more The name H-back can be confusing, because the H-back rarely carries the ball as running backs do; instead, the H-back plays a position similar to a tight end.
